Hello, I have 05 545i and recently Ipod interface have been added and dealer updated software.
After the software update, Bluetooth set up screen is disappeared from the screen. My car is at dealer for two days now but still BMW dealer don't know how to fix this issue.

Does anyone has any good idea ? Please help.

Here is a thought.

If the programming crashed and they had to install the car's full software from scratch, then they have to revert the vehicle coding to where it was when it left the factory. If the car did not leave the factory with the ipod adapter, then it would not be reprogrammed automatically, it would have to be manually added back in to the vehicle software.
